Sprint 1
Autor: william
Duração: Duas semanas
Término: Sprint 2
Total de pontos: 31
ID |
Tema |
Épico |
História de usuário |
Pontos |
US005 |
Cadastro |
Integração com APIs |
Realizar cadastro com o Facebook |
8 |
US004 |
Cadastro |
Integração com APIs |
Realizar cadastro com o Google |
8 |
US055 |
Perfil |
|
Editar Perfil |
5 |
US039 |
Login |
Integração com APIs |
Realizar login via Facebook |
5 |
US041 |
Login |
Integração com APIs |
Realizar login via Google |
5 |
US004 - Realizar cadastro com o Google
Eu, como usuário desejo realizar cadastro com o Google para que eu possa me tornar um usuário via integração com uma conta existente da Google.
Critérios de aceitação:
- Caso ocorra uma falha no processo de integração, o usuário deve receber um feedback visual.
- Caso o cadastro seja efetuado com sucesso, o usuário deve ser redirecionado à página de customização de interesses.
US005 - Realizar cadastro com o Facebook
Eu, como usuário desejo realizar cadastro com o Facebook para que eu possa me tornar um usuário via integração com uma conta existente do Facebook.
Critérios de aceitação:
- Caso ocorra uma falha no processo de integração, o usuário deve receber um feedback visual.
- Caso o cadastro seja efetuado com sucesso, o usuário deve ser redirecionado à página de customização de interesses.
US055 - Editar Perfil
Eu, como usuário desejo editar perfil para que eu possa editar alterar as informações do meu perfil de acordo com o meu querer.
Critérios de aceitação:
- O usuário deve ser capaz de alterar sua foto de perfil
- O usuário deve ser capaz de alterar seu nome de usuário
- O usuário deve ser capaz de introduz uma pequena autobiografia
- O usuário deve ser capaz de salvar as alterações em seu perfil
- O usuário deve ser capaz de cancelar as alterações em seu perfil
US039 - Realizar login via Facebook
Eu, como usuário desejo realizar login via Facebook para que eu possa me conectar a minha conta via integração com o Facebook
Critérios de aceitação:
- Caso ocorra uma falha no processo de integração, o usuário deve receber um feedback visual.
- Caso o cadastro seja efetuado com sucesso, o usuário deve ser redirecionado à página principal da aplicação.
US041 - Realizar login via Google
Eu, como usuário desejo realizar login via Google para que eu possa me conectar a minha conta via integração com o Google
Critérios de aceitação:
- Caso ocorra uma falha no processo de integração, o usuário deve receber um feedback visual.
- Caso o cadastro seja efetuado com sucesso, o usuário deve ser redirecionado à página principal da aplicação.
Sprint 2
Autor: Matheus
Duração: Duas semanas
Término: Sprint 3
Total de pontos: 31
ID |
Tema |
Épico |
História de usuário |
Pontos |
US063
|
Storie |
|
Escrever ‘new storie |
8 |
US059
|
Serie |
|
Criar uma nova serie |
8 |
US061 |
Serie |
|
Deletar uma serie existente |
5 |
US006 |
Conexões |
Configurações |
Conectar com Facebook |
5 |
US008 |
Conexões |
Configurações |
Conectar com Facebook |
5 |
US063 - Escrever ‘New Storie’
Eu, como usuário desejo escrever e publicar novas histórias
Critérios de aceitação:
- O usuário deve ser capaz de adicionar:
- Título;
- Texto;
- Imagem;
- Gifs;
- O usuário deve ser capaz de adicionar tags ao seu texto;
- O usuário deve ser capaz de salvar o rascunho da história;
- O usuário deve ser capaz de adicionar uma imagem prévia da história;
US059 - Criar uma nova Serie
Eu, como usuário desejo publicar conjuntos de textos sequenciais
Critérios de aceitação:
- O usuário deve ser capaz de adicionar:
- Título;
- Texto;
- Imagem;
- Gifs;
- O usuário deve ser capaz de adicionar tags a sua serie;
- O usuário deve ser capaz de salvar o rascunho da serie;
- O usuário deve ser capaz de adicionar uma imagem prévia da história;
- O usuário deve ser capaz de ver a prévia da série, em formato de cards;
- O usuário deve ser capaz de enviar a prévia da série para o aplicativo de telefone;
US061 - Deletar uma serie existente
Eu, como usuário desejo remover, por motivos pessoais, uma serie de minha lista de rascunhos ou publicadas
Critérios de aceitação:
- O usuário deve ser capaz de remover a serie de suas publicações com o clique de um botão;
- O usuário deve receber uma confirmação visual de deletamento da serie;
- O usuário deve receber um feedback visual caso o processo tenha falhado.
US006 - Conectar com Facebook
Eu, como usuário desejo realizar uma integração com o Facebook, adicionando uma nova forma de login
Critérios de aceitação:
- Caso ocorra uma falha no processo de integração, o usuário deve receber um feedback visual;
- O usuário deve ser redirecionado à página de autorização do Facebook para confirmação da integração;
- Caso o cadastro seja efetuado com sucesso, o usuário deve ser redirecionado à página de configurações do Medium.
US006 - Conectar com Google
Eu, como usuário desejo realizar uma integração com o Google, adicionando uma nova forma de login
Critérios de aceitação:
- Caso ocorra uma falha no processo de integração, o usuário deve receber um feedback visual;
- O usuário deve ser redirecionado à página de autorização do Google para confirmação da integração;
- Caso o cadastro seja efetuado com sucesso, o usuário deve ser redirecionado à página de configurações do Medium.
Sprint 3
Autor: Luís
Duração: Duas semanas
Término: Sprint 4
Total de pontos: 21
ID |
Tema |
Épico |
História de usuário |
Pontos |
US023 |
Configuração |
Conta |
Desativar conta |
5 |
US024 |
Configuração |
Conta |
Deletar conta |
5 |
US026 |
Interação |
|
Seguir usuários |
3 |
US064 |
Storie |
|
Importar 'storie' |
8 |
US023 – Desativar conta
Eu, como usuário, desejo desativar a minha conta do Medium e remover o seu conteúdo momentaneamente. Desejo que ao realizar o login novamente ela seja restaurada junto com seu conteúdo.
Critérios de aceitação:
- O usuário deve ser capaz de desativar sua conta e seu conteúdo;
- A conta deve ser restaurada juntamente com seu conteúdo ao realizado o login novamente.
- Caso ocorra uma falha no processo de desativação, o usuário deve receber um feedback visual.
US024 – Deletar conta
Eu, como usuário, desejo deletar a minha conta do Medium e remover o seu conteúdo definitivamente.
Critérios de aceitação:
- O usuário deve ser capaz de deletar sua conta completamente junto com seu conteúdo;
- Caso ocorra uma falha no processo de deletar conta, o usuário deve receber um feedback visual.
- O usuário não deverá ser capaz de realizar o login novamente com a mesma conta
US026 – Seguir usuários
Eu, como usuário, desejo seguir outros usuários e ser capaz de ver mais facilmente os textos por eles publicados e que os interessam.
Critérios de aceitação:
- O usuário deve ser capaz de seguir outros usuários.
- O usuário deve ser capaz de ver uma lista de todos os usuários que segue em seu perfil.
- O usuário deve ser capaz de acessar rapidamente o perfil dos usuários que segue.
US64 – Importar ‘storie’
Eu, como usuário escritor, desejo aproveitar uma história já publicada por min em outro lugar para editá-la e/ou publicá-la nas minhas histórias Medium
Critérios de aceitação:
- O usuário escritor deve possuir um link válido do site onde consta o post original que deseja importar para o Medium.
- O usuário escrito deve ser capaz de importar o texto de outro site em suas histórias no Medium.
- Caso ocorra alguma falha no processo de importação, o usuário deve receber um feedback visual.
Sprint 4
Autor: Aline
Duração: Duas semanas
Término: Sprint 6
Total de pontos: 27
ID |
Tema |
Épico |
História de usuário |
Pontos |
US007 |
Conexões |
|
Conectar com twitter |
5 |
US042 |
Login |
integração |
Login via E-mail |
5 |
US056 |
Perfil |
|
Visualizar próprio perfil |
3 |
US057 |
Perfil |
|
Editar nome de usuário |
1 |
US031 |
Interação |
|
Visualizar comentários da storie |
3 |
US032 |
Interação |
|
Reportar storie |
5 |
US019 |
Configuração |
notificação |
Ativar/desativar notificação por e-mail |
5 |
US007 – Conectar com twitter
Eu, como usuário, desejo conectar a minha conta do Medium com o Twitter, para que eu possa realizar uma integração com o Twitter, adicionando uma nova forma de login.
Critérios de aceitação:
- O usuário deve ser capaz de clicar em botão que abra uma janela para que ele efetue o login na sua conta do Twitter;
- Após o login no Twitter ter sido efetuado, o sistema deverá pegar os dados da conta do Twitter do usuário e vincular com do usuário no Medium;
- Após o login no Twitter ter sido efetuado, o usuário deverá ser redirecionado para a página de configurações;
- Após o login no Twitter ter sido efetuado, o usuário deverá ter um feedback visual que mostra a conexão do Twitter com a conta do Medium;
US042 – Login via E-mail
Eu, como usuário, desejo efetuar o login com o E-mail, para que eu possa me conectar a conta do Medium usando o E-mail em que eu cadastrei na minha nela.
Critérios de aceitação:
- Caso ocorra uma falha no processo de login, o usuário deve receber um feedback visual.
- Caso o login seja efetuado com sucesso, o usuário deve ser redirecionado à página principal da aplicação.
US056 – Visualizar próprio perfil
Eu, como usuário, desejo ter acesso a todos os dados do meu perfil no Medium, para que eu possa visualizar os dados dele.
Critérios de aceitação:
- O usuário tem como acessar uma página com dados do seu perfil;
- Na página de perfil, o sistema retorna todos os dados do perfil do usuário;
US057 – Editar nome de usuário
Eu, como usuário, desejo editar o meu nome de usuário no Medium, para que eu possa alterar o meu nome de usuário.
Critérios de aceitação:
- O usuário tem como editar o seu nome de usuário no Medium;
- Após a edição, o usuário é redirecionado para a sua página de perfil e consegue ver a edição no seu nome de usuário;
US031 – Visualizar comentários da storie
Eu, como usuário, desejo visualizar os comentários de uma storie, para que eu possa ler todos os comentários feitos em uma storie.
Critérios de aceitação:
- O usuário tem como visualizar todos comentários feitos em uma storie;
US032 – Reportar storie
Eu, como usuário, desejo poder reportar uma storie, para que eu possa denunciar uma storie que considerei ofensiva e contribuir positivamente para a saúde mental da comunidade em questão.
Critérios de aceitação:
- O usuário deve poder visualizar um ícone para iniciar o processo de reportar uma storie;
- Após reportar uma storie, o usuário recebe um feedback visual mostrando que a storie foi reportada;
US019 – Ativar/desativar notificação por e-mail
Eu, como usuário, desejo poder ativar e/ou desativar o recebimento de notificações por e-mail, para que eu possa selecionar entre receber ou não notificações por e-mail.
Critérios de aceitação:
- O usuário pode ativar e/ou desativar o recebimento de notificações por e-mail;
- Após ativar e/ou desativar o recebimento de notificações por e-mail, o usuário recebe um feedback visual mostrando a ação efetuada por ele;
Sprint 5
Autores: Aline e william
Duração: Duas semanas
Término: Sprint 6
Total de pontos: 26
ID |
Tema |
Épico |
História de usuário |
Pontos |
US010
|
Configuração |
notificação |
Ativar/desativar notificação social |
5 |
US040
|
Login |
Integração via API |
Login via twitter |
5 |
US025 |
Interação |
|
Seguir escritores |
3 |
US029 |
Interação |
|
Visualizar perfis de outros |
5 |
US071 |
Interação |
|
Visualizar storie |
8 |
US010 – Ativar/desativar notificação social
Eu, como usuário, desejo receber ou não notificações de medias sociais.
Critérios de aceitação:
- O usuário poderá, por meio de checkbox selecionar o status para recebimento de notificação em suas redes socias.
US040 – Login via twitter
Eu, como usuário, desejo me conectar a minha conta via integração com o Twitter.
Critérios de aceitação:
- Caso ocorra uma falha no processo de integração, o usuário deve receber um feedback visual.
- Caso o cadastro seja efetuado com sucesso, o usuário deve ser redirecionado à página principal da aplicação.
US025 – Seguir escritor
Eu, como usuário, desejo receber notificações das histórias deles.
Critérios de aceitação:
- O usuário, ao ler um dado texto, deve ser capaz de visualizar informações básicas do escritor;
- O usuário deve ser capaz de visualizar um ícone para seguir o escritor;
- O usuário deve ser capaz de deixar de seguir o escritor.
US029 – Visualizar perfis de outros usuários
Eu, como usuário, desejo ver seus históricos de leitura/Escolher segui-los ou não/Achar novos assuntos de interesse.
Critérios de aceitação:
- O usuário deve conseguir clicar na foto de perfil de outro usuário e ser redirecionado a página de dados do mesmo;
- O usuário poderá ver os seguintes dados:
- Nome
- foto de perfil
- claps
US071 – Visualizar storie
Eu, como usuário, desejo ler um texto na íntegra e realizar outras ações posteriores relacionadas ao mesmo.
Critérios de aceitação:
- O usuário deverá ser capaz de clicar no título do artigo e ser redirecionado a página de conteúdo do mesmo;
- O usuário terá como possíveis ações:
- comentar trecho do texto lido
- aplaudir texto lido
- dar clap no texto lido
- seguir escritor responsável pelo texto lido
- O usuário deve ser capaz de sair da página de leitura se for de seu querer
Rastro de Tema | Origem |
---|---|
Geral | Priorização First Things First / Brainstorming |
Configuração | Storytelling - Configurar Aplicação |
Editar perfil | Storyboard - Editar Perfil |
Storie | Storytelling - Escrever 'New Storie' |
Cadastro | Storyboard - Cadastro e Login |
Login | Storyboard - Cadastro e Login |